On Mon, 20 Apr 2009, Jennifer Smith <jds at randomgang.com> wrote:
> Hallgeirr wrote:
> > Vert, a winged wagon wheel Or within an annulet Or, between three
> > mullets of five greater and five lesser points argent.
> >
> > The color drawing can be viewed at
> > http://www.flickr.com/photos/18277217@N08/3461689066/
>
> The next problem that would be introduced then is that, as I see it,
> you have a wagon wheel, pair of wings, and an annulet all in the
> same charge group. This is cause for return under the "no
> slot-machine" rule: RfS VIII.1.a says:
>
>     1. Armorial Simplicity. - All armory must be simple in design.
>        a. Tincture and Charge Limit - Armory must use a limited
>           number of tinctures and types of charges.
>           ...As another guideline, three or more types of charges
>           should not be used in the same group.

Thing is, I don't think that they are "in the same group".  "A charge
within a circular charge" is not a standard arrangement in the same
way that "two and one" or "in saltire" are.

More definitely, I see the wheel as one charge -- a winged-wheel, so
to speak.
